The nature of sourdough yeast microflora was investigated. Samples were collected from different bakeries that do not use starter cultures, but rely on the traditional art of bread making. Pulsed field gel electrophoresis (PFGE), PCR/RFLP of the Non-Transcribed Spacer 2 (NTS2), the inter δ regions and the Internal Transcribed Spacer (ITS) of the ribosomal DNA (rDNA) and partial sequencing of the 26S rDNA were used to identify and differentiate the yeast cultures isolated. In particular, PCR/RFLP of the ITS region, with restriction enzyme Hae III made it possible to differentiate Candida milleri from Candida humilis. A high degree of polymorphism was observed in the inter-δ regions of the strains belonging to the S. cerevisiae, species; contrary to what has been mentioned in literature, strains with the same profile are not necessarily identical. Saccharymyces cerevisiae, Saccharomyces cerevisiae old type anamensis, Issatchenkia orientalis, Candida milleri and Candida humilis were found to be the predominant species in Sicilian sourdough.
